The short version

Pinos Altos has notably lower household income than the US average, with a median household income of $7,188. The city has more than doubled in size since 2011, adding 177 residents. 100%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, well above the national rate of 28%. With a median age of 56.4, the population is older than the US median of 37.2. The poverty rate of 44.4% is well above the national figure. Households here earn about 84% less than the New Mexico median.
